What changed here
DerivedThe seat changed hands: Shiromani Akali Dal (SAD) lost it to Indian National Congress (INC), which now leads by 14.0%.
- INC vote shareINC went from 39.2% to 52.8% of the vote here (+13.6%).
- Multi-cornered3 candidates cleared 5% — a genuinely multi-cornered fight.
